FTSE 100 Climbs 0.59% as International Airlines Soars 4.33% Amid Strong Market Sentiment
The FTSE 100 index has demonstrated strong upward momentum, increasing by 0.59% today and 1.43% over the past week, with a notable 2.44% rise in the last month. International Consolidated Airlines Group SA led large-cap gains at 4.33%, while Experian Plc fell by 4.65%. In mid-caps, Burberry Group Plc rose 5.17%, contrasting with Softcat Plc's 3.63% decline. Small-cap Ceres Power Holdings plc excelled with an 8.16% gain, while Frontier Developments Plc dropped 4.9%. Overall, the market shows a positive sentiment, with more advancing stocks than declining ones across all categories.
